Welcome to my personal website! I'm excited to share a bit about myself and my journey. With a diverse background in the military and software development, I bring a unique set of skills and experiences to the table.

During my time as a Navy Corpsman, I had the privilege of training over 500 Marines in lifesaving medical techniques. This hands-on experience taught me the importance of precision and quick thinking in high-pressure situations. It was a fulfilling and humbling role that instilled in me a strong sense of duty and attention to detail.

Transitioning into the world of software development, I found my passion for optimizing cloud infrastructure, implementing DevOps practices, and diving into full-stack development. Over the years, I have honed my expertise in delivering high-quality software applications and streamlining development processes. One of my key accomplishments has been optimizing Azure environments, ensuring optimal performance and uptime for various projects.

What sets me apart is my ability to seamlessly blend my military discipline and teamwork skills with the dynamic nature of the software development industry. I thrive in collaborative environments, leveraging diverse perspectives to drive innovation and deliver effective solutions. As a leader, I have guided and mentored junior developers, fostering a culture of growth and continuous learning within the teams I work with.

Communication is another strength of mine, both in technical and non-technical contexts. Whether I'm conveying complex technical concepts or articulating ideas to stakeholders, I strive to ensure clear and concise communication. This skill has proven invaluable in bridging the gap between technical and business perspectives.

With a strong work ethic, resilience, and the ability to perform under pressure, I embrace challenges head-on. My disciplined approach to setting goals and staying focused enables me to consistently strive for excellence in everything I do. I believe in continuous improvement and constantly expanding my technical skill set to stay ahead in the ever-evolving software development landscape.

I am passionate about emerging technologies and their potential to transform industries. With an unwavering commitment to excellence, I am eager to contribute my diverse skill set, dedication, and ability to perform under pressure to future projects and organizations. Together, let's make a meaningful impact in the world of software development.

